On Tuesday 29 March 2005 00:43, Andrew Zschetzsche wrote:
> I have a few questions regarding the extras testing branch.
>
> 1.  What is "testing"?  Is it that the program installs with out a hickup?
Testing is my branch of YDL extras. Bare minimum they build. Although I 
usually do try to verify that they at least start. Many of the packages are 
ports of fedora-extras packages.
> 2.  Can regulars to the list submit binary rpm's?  And where?
No.
> 2a.  I don't quite have a stock machine anymore.  If we want to submit
> something, should we submit a source rpm, or the binary?  Are the
> submitted/suggested packages compiled on a known stock machine?
that's ok, if you can mail me a *LINK* to the srpm, I'll rebuld it and try to 
basic sanity check it, then drop it into ydl extras testing and announce it 
to the ydl-extras list. *if* enough people say, "yeah it works" without any 
bugs, we'll move it into testing.
